Heads-up for anyone new to the Larkspur firmware team: the update channel logic in this diff gates rollout by device cohort, not region. The staged delay between cohorts is intentional — rushing it has bricked Pindrop units before. If you change any of these, loop in the platform group first. The current tuning constants are as follows.

tuning table, hafog-bahaf:
QUOTAS = {
    "praion": 144,
    "briax": 906,
    "silwyn": 451,
}

## Further reading

If your plugin hits the Veldrix session-token refresh bug (tokens silently expiring mid-request after the v4.2 auth rework), don't retry blindly — the gateway returns 200 with an empty body, not a 401. Workarounds and the patch timeline are tracked internally. Plugin authors should pin the SDK to 4.1.9 until the fix ships. Full details, affected versions, and the mitigation matrix live on our internal page.

runbook for yajog-tahag: https://jira.norvasys.corp/spaces/job/display/ca5ff3fa4d4d

## Gateway rate limiting vars

Portcullis (internal gateway) reads limits at boot. Key vars: `PC_RATE_WINDOW_SECONDS` (default 60), `PC_RATE_MAX_REQUESTS` (default 1200), `PC_BURST_ALLOWANCE` (default 50). Changing any requires a rolling restart — coordinate with Marla before cutting the release. Per-tenant overrides live in the `limits.d/` directory, not env vars. The limiter also talks to the shared quota store, which is authenticated. Append the quota store credential to the gateway's `.env` directly after this line.

vault entry, kafog-yahop: COURIER_KEY8=0faa53ae

Welcome to the Lanternleaf consent banner program. Plugin authors must register each banner variant before rollout so the Driftgate compliance checker can validate copy, locale coverage, and dismissal behavior. Please test against the staging consent ledger rather than production; consent records are immutable once written, and malformed entries cannot be purged without a formal review. To connect your local plugin harness to the staging ledger, configure your client with the connection string below.

replica DSN, hadug-yajep: postgresql://aldiel_svc:W4u8z42Jo5IFtG@db-1656.torvacorp.local:5432/holael